Spiritual Gangster is partnering with the La Jolla Group and utilizing the company’s backend operating platform as the yoga brand prepares for more growth.
Going forward, the La Jolla Group, which has acquired a stake in the brand, will handle functions like operations, productions, finance, ERP and 3PL.
“Through the joint venture LJG will become an equity partner in the brand which will fuel a truly aligned pursuit of success,” La Jolla Group CEO Daniel Neukomm said.
The operational partnership will allow the Spiritual Gangster team to focus on design, marketing and sales from its Venice headquarters.
Industry veteran Terry Strumpf joined the brand as President six months ago and has hired new sales reps, added showrooms in Los Angeles and New York, and signed with a new distributor in Canada.
The brand is growing rapidly, and the Spiritual Gangster team believes the new arrangement with the La Jolla Group will help the brand scale the business.
“With La Jolla Group’s operational expertise, Spiritual Gangster’s impressive growth will be accelerated,” Terry said.
Spiritual Gangster is a favorite of celebrities and is sold by retailers such as Nordstrom, Bloomingdale’s, Shopbop, Corepower Yoga, Equinox, and Carbon 38.
